The Importance Of Plastic Wrapping In Everyday Life

plastic wrapping is a common item that most people encounter on a daily basis, yet its importance is often overlooked. From protecting food products to keeping items clean and organized, plastic wrapping serves a vital role in our everyday lives.

One of the key benefits of plastic wrapping is its ability to preserve and protect food items. Whether it’s wrapping sandwiches for lunch or sealing leftovers in the fridge, plastic wrapping helps to keep food fresh and prevent spoilage. This is especially important in a world where food waste is a significant issue, as plastic wrapping can extend the shelf life of perishable items and reduce the amount of food that is thrown away.

In addition to preserving food, plastic wrapping is also essential for transporting and storing goods. Whether it’s wrapping pallets of products for shipping or protecting items from dust and dirt in storage, plastic wrapping provides a cost-effective and efficient solution for businesses and consumers alike. With various types of plastic wrapping available, including shrink wrap and stretch wrap, there is a versatile option for every packaging need.

Another important function of plastic wrapping is its ability to keep items clean and protected. Whether it’s wrapping furniture during a move or covering electronics to prevent dust buildup, plastic wrapping provides a barrier against contaminants that can damage or degrade valuable items. This is especially useful for items that are stored for long periods of time, as plastic wrapping can help to maintain the condition of the items until they are ready for use.

plastic wrapping also plays a crucial role in maintaining hygiene and safety standards in various industries. For example, in the medical field, plastic wrapping is used to protect sterile instruments and supplies from contamination. In the food industry, plastic wrapping is essential for packaging products to prevent cross-contamination and ensure that food is safe for consumption. Without plastic wrapping, these industries would face significant challenges in maintaining the strict standards required to keep people safe and healthy.
